Georgia Neurosurgical
Society's 2009 Annual Fall meeting is set to take place November 21, 2009. From
the outstanding educational program to discovering the world's largest aquarium,
you will not want to miss this year's event at the Georgia Aquarium@ Georgia Aquarium
features more animals than any other aquarium in more than eight million gallons
of water. Through a path of more than sixty exhibits, the Aquarium tells a
global water story, with features modeled after the greatest zoos and aquariums
in the world. Each majestic exhibit is designed to inspire, entertain and
educate. Georgia Aquarium is an
entertaining, intriguing and educational experience for guests of all ages.
While promoting a fun and enjoyable learning experience, the Aquarium instills
in its guests a new appreciation for the world's aquatic biodiversity. The Aquarium enhances
the Georgia tourism offerings and provides local residents with a world-class
entertainment attraction. It is an anchor for downtown's revitalization efforts
being a benefit to tboth the city and the state. To date, Georgia Aquarium has
attracted more than six million visitors since its opening on November 23,
2005. This year's honored
